Tell me everything! Prepare yourself, since every year beginning in 1999, Pantone announces a defining hue. This choice aims to capture the current cultural mood—informing everything from our emotions and what we wear to how we design our living spaces. 2025's selection was the deep beige "a coffee-inspired shade," following the subtly inviting "a delicate peach tone." The latest selection, however, is even more puzzling. It is "Cloud Dancer," described by a "billowy, balanced white." Laurie Pressman, vice-president of the Pantone Color Institute, remarked that it is "a pivotal neutral tone … enabling all colors to shine." Well, Cloud Dancer sounds… wait, white?
